TrUe IdEnTiTy
I am a CONFUSED and CURIOUS girl who hides my true feelings,
 I wonder how my parents might react towards me for being bisexual . . but who cares,
 I hear people screaming and crying because of a worthless secrets; Im sharing my crazy fact because no one dares,
 I see people rejecting my sexuality and cursing my life,
 I want people to step away from suicide and step away from the knife,
 I am a CONFUSED and CURIOUS girl who hides my true feelings
 
 I pretend to smile when i would rather be crying,
 I feel that everyone looks at me in a bad way when Im walking by but when I ask them what is wrong;everybody would be lying,
 I touch the invisible objects called my dreams,
 I worry that people will judge me for the person i truly am but it is not as scary as it seems,
 I cry because it is the best way to ease my pain instead of cutting myself and hide the scars,
 I am a CONFUSED and CURIOUS girl who hides my true feelings
 
 I understand that karma will always be in the race for success right on our side,
 I say”Life is to short for drama so just laugh it off and walk away with pride”,
 I dream of carbon fiber hoods on a Skyline and Audi R-8 with the lead lights,
 I try to ignore my family and stay away from the fights,
 I hope the only thing stopping me to touch the stars is my home ceilings, 
 I am a CONFUSED and CURIOUS girl who hides my true feelings
